The difference between a clothing store that's merely present and one that actually serves its customers usually comes down to understanding fit, stock rotation, and honest sizing. Therapy distinguishes itself through careful attention to these fundamentals. The team knows that buying clothes is a confidence transaction — people need to feel they're being fitted properly, not sold what's in stock — and that sizing varies wildly across brands and origins, which matters in a diverse city like Johannesburg. Stock isn't kept static or seasonal in the traditional sense; it moves based on what customers are asking for and what works in practice. This kind of attentiveness requires experience in reading customer needs, staying current with multiple brand specifications, and not treating inventory as something to push through regardless of fit. It's a more demanding approach than simple retail, and it shows in how customers return.

In Johannesburg, independent clothing stores sometimes offer unique local items not found at national chains. Sizing consistency varies between brands, so trying on before buying is advisable. For children's clothing, checking that the store stocks your required age range saves time.
